Leasing And Occupancy Specialist II

WinnCompanies is searching for a Leasing And Occupancy Specialist II to join our team at The Reserve at Jackson Highway, a 102-unit residential tax credit community located in Covington, GA. In this role, you will perform all day-to-day leasing and marketing activities related to apartment rentals, move-ins, recertifications, and lease renewals. The ideal candidate will also provide outstanding service to customers, residents, and clients while maintaining budgeted occupancy at the highest attainable rents at all times. This position will be required to work most weekends. Responsibilities Interact with prospective and current residents to achieve maximum occupancy. Generate and manage traffic, lotteries, wait list, property tours, leasing apartments, qualifying prospects, and following up on prospect leads. Prepare lease documentation applicable to program types, complete move-in paperwork and procedures, maintain applicable databases, and ensure tour route, amenity areas, and show units are to company standard. Deliver customer service that exceeds expectations for new and current residents. Educate and implement WinnCompanies programs, processes, and policies to new and current residents as applicable. Review, prioritize, and distribute resident service requests as required. May assist on-site management with ensuring all marketing documents, supplies, reports, advertisements, and web content are current and updated a necessary based on property, regional or corporate initiatives. Maintain relationships with area businesses, local housing offices, employers, and real estate brokers to generate new business or to maintain an extensive waiting list for all unit types. Remain current with local events and hiring trends that may have an impact on the property. Maintain knowledge and understanding of current and sub markets, including competitors and customer demographics. Gather appropriate documents by program types for residency approval submission during the application or recertification process. Remain up to date with federal, state, or other regulatory requirements and programs.
